POSITION BACKGROUND:
The HSLP Advisor provides specialized advice and guidance to company employees at all levels, to ensure compliance with policies, procedures, and legislation. This position requires that the HSLP Advisor handles all day-to-day safety issues that arise in Ketek buildings, yards, and job sites.
CORE DUTIES:
Compliance
- Record and investigate complaints, identified hazards, and specialized unplanned events
- Conduct HSE audits, reviews, and risk assessments
- Assist with weekly safety meetings for applicable company branch locations
- Assist with the creation and updates of various company Formal Hazard Assessments
- Conduct and document regular/quarterly facility/branch safety inspections
- Audit client & contractor safety programs against applicable legislation
Program Facilitation
- Monitor and evaluate occupational health and safety programs to ensure compliance with applicable provincial regulations
- Coordinate unplanned event investigations and ensure effective corrective actions are properly implemented
- Enforce health & safety program elements and provide subject matter expertise
- Support the emergency preparedness processes and assist with ERP training exercises
- Manage client safety requests and requirements
- Review & respond to hazard assessments, hazard IDs and other proactive reports
- Mentor/educate company personnel regarding health & safety
Other Duties
- Coordinate with HR, Training, and BT Leads regarding safety initiatives
- Support, coach and mentor the Health & Safety Committee, where applicable
- Promote a culture of safety excellence
- Observe all safety procedures and use proper PPE when applicable
- Create & update company policies, procedures, standards and the safety manual
- Be considerate of the needs of our community and the environment
- Represent the Company in a manner that aligns with Management values, as well as the corporate vision and mission statements
